Early Career Entry-Level Positions

So many great careers start at SAS. Ready to explore the possibilities?

We hire based on business need into a variety of technical and non-technical roles. If you are a self-starter and independent thinker, SAS could be a great fit as you start your new career.

  • Technical Roles: Test Engineer, DevOps Web Engineer, Cloud Consulting Business Development Manager, Software Developer in HLS, Software Developer Engineer in Test.
  • Non-Technical Roles: Inside Sales Account Representative, Project Manager, Project Coordinator, Consulting Business Development Manager.
